Color steel plate suitable for metal roof building integrated photovoltaics (BIPV) system
The invention relates to a color steel plate, the color steel plate comprises a finish paint layer, the material of the finishing coat layer contains a filler, and the filler comprises a flaky filler and a granular filler; wherein the adding amount of the filler accounts for 20-50% of the total weight of the finish paint layer material; and the addition amount of the flaky filler accounts for 20-40% of the weight of the filler. The color steel plate disclosed by the invention is suitable for a metal roof BIPV system, and has excellent adhesiveness, heat and humidity resistance and adhesive force.
